Denard Robinson and Braylon Edwards are among former Michigan players suing NCAA and Big Ten Network | Advertiser-Tribune Former Michigan football stars Denard Robinson and Braylon Edwards are suing the NCAA and Big Ten Network with other former Wolverines players, claiming they lost out on more than $50 million during their college careers because of the association's now-lifted ban on athletes being compensated for name, image and likeness.
